What is Hard Water?
Hard water is characterized by its mineral web content, especially calcium and magnesium ions. These minerals enter the supply of water as it percolates via sedimentary rock and chalk down payments underground. When tough water is warmed or left to stand, it tends to form scale, a crusty buildup that follows surfaces and can trigger a range of issues in plumbing systems.
Impacts on Pipes
Hard water influences pipelines in numerous harmful ways, mainly with scale buildup, decreased water circulation, and raised corrosion.
Scale Buildup
Among the most usual problems caused by tough water is range build-up inside pipes and components. As water streams via the plumbing system, minerals speed up out and stick to the pipe wall surfaces. Over time, this build-up can narrow pipe openings, causing lowered water circulation and raised pressure on the system.
Reduced Water Flow
Natural resources from tough water can gradually decrease the diameter of pipes, limiting water circulation to taps, showers, and home appliances. This decreased circulation not only impacts water pressure yet likewise enhances energy consumption as devices like hot water heater need to work harder to supply the very same amount of hot water.
Deterioration
While difficult water minerals themselves do not create deterioration, they can worsen existing corrosion concerns in pipes. Range buildup can catch water against metal surfaces, speeding up the corrosion process and possibly bring about leakages or pipeline failure over time.

Water Softeners
Water conditioners are the most usual solution for dealing with tough water. They work by trading calcium and magnesium ions with sodium or potassium ions, properly decreasing the solidity of the water.
Other Therapy Alternatives
In addition to water softeners, various other treatment choices include magnetic water conditioners, reverse osmosis systems, and chemical ingredients. Each approach has its advantages and suitability depending upon the intensity of the difficult water trouble and home needs.

The Science Behind Hard Water
Hard water is a common condition affecting many residential areas and industries around the world, distinguished by its high content of dissolved minerals, specifically calcium and magnesium. Understanding the science behind hard water is essential to comprehending its various effects on plumbing, appliances, and daily life.
What is Hard Water?
At its core, hard water is water that contains a high concentration of dissolved minerals. While it can contain various minerals, the primary components contributing to water hardness are calcium and magnesium ions. These minerals are harmless to human health; in fact, they contribute to the dietary intake of these essential elements. However, their presence in water at high concentrations leads to several water damage, particularly in household and industrial settings.
Why Does Hard Water Occur?
The hardness of water is primarily determined by the water's journey through the environment. As rainwater percolates through the soil and into aquifers, it naturally dissolves minerals from the rocks and sediment it encounters. The types of rocks and minerals present in a particular region significantly influence the hardness of the local water supply.
Geographical Variance in Water Hardness
Water hardness varies significantly from one geographical location to another, primarily due to the geological composition of the land. Regions with extensive limestone and dolomite deposits tend to have harder water because these minerals easily dissolve into the water supply. Conversely, areas with granite or other less soluble rock formations typically have softer water.
Economic Implications of Hard Water
The presence of hard water in a bathroom, kitchen or industrial setting extends beyond mere inconvenience; it harbors significant economic implications that can affect the bottom line of homeowners and businesses alike. From increased energy bills to the premature need for appliance replacement, the hidden costs of hard water can accumulate, making it an issue worth addressing.
Increased Energy Bills
One of the most immediate economic impacts of hard water is the increase in energy consumption and, consequently, higher energy bills. When water contains high levels of minerals like calcium and magnesium, it leads to the formation of scale within pipes and on heating elements. This scale acts as an insulator, reducing the efficiency of a water heaters by forcing them to use more energy to reach your desired temperature for a hot water.
Frequent Repairs and Maintenance

Early Appliance Replacement
Perhaps one of the most significant economic implications of hard water is the shortened lifespan of household appliances. Appliances that frequently come into contact with hard water, such as tankless water heaters, washing machines, and dishwashers, are prone to scale buildup and the subsequent stress it places on their components.
This not only leads to a decrease in efficiency but also accelerates wear and tear, culminating in the need for premature replacement. The cost of replacing these appliances is substantial, representing a significant investment that homeowners must face more frequently than those with soft water systems.
Additional Costs
Beyond the direct costs associated with increased energy consumption, repairs, and appliance replacement, there are additional economic implications to consider. The inefficiency in soap and detergent usage, for instance, results from hard water's reaction with soap to form scum, requiring more product to achieve the desired cleaning effect.
Furthermore, the impact on textiles and clothing can lead to faster degradation of fabrics, necessitating more frequent replacements. These indirect costs, while less obvious, contribute to the overall economic burden of hard water on households.
